"Russia’s Luna-25 automatic interplanetary station has collided with the Moon.....“According to the results of a preliminary analysis… the Luna-25
spacecraft switched to a non-designated orbit and ceased to operate due
to a collision with the surface of the Moon,” Roscosmos said." RT

"The US imposed sanctions
on three entities over alleged weapons deals between North Korea
and
Russia. The three – Versor, Verus and Defense Engineering – are linked
to Slovakian national Ashot Mkrtychev, who was sanctioned in March for
attempting to facilitate arms deals between Russia and North Korea." AlJareeza
